Match your data allowance to your travel style. Here’s a breakdown based on common Slovak itineraries.
For a 2-4 day trip focused on Bratislava or Košice, a 1-3 GB plan is usually ample.
A longer journey combining cities and nature calls for 5-10 GB. This covers moderate social media use, some video calls, and daily navigation.
If your trip includes uploading many videos from hiking the Tatra trails or frequent video conferencing, lean toward the 10 GB+ range. Remember, using a hotspot for a laptop will consume data faster.
Month-long adventures or remote work assignments benefit from larger plans (10-20 GB) or unlimited data options. Look for providers offering renewable plans, allowing you to top up seamlessly without getting a new eSIM, perfect for a base in Bratislava's Petržalka district or a longer stay in Poprad.

Popular apps use varying amounts of data. Approximate hourly use: Maps (5-10 MB), Social Media browsing (50-100 MB), WhatsApp/Signal calls (300-500 MB). Plan your data package accordingly.
Your eSIM's mobile data is more secure than public Wi-Fi. Use it for sensitive tasks like online banking. For an extra layer of privacy, especially on shared networks in coworking spaces, consider using a reputable VPN.

How quickly does a Slovakia eSIM activate?
Typically within 2-5 minutes of scanning the QR code. You can activate before departure or upon landing, connecting you to networks like O2 Slovakia instantly.
Can I use my regular WhatsApp number?
Absolutely. WhatsApp remains linked to your primary number. Keep your physical SIM active for SMS verification; use the eSIM for data, and WhatsApp works normally.
Is mobile hotspot/tethering supported?
Yes, most plans allow it. Perfect for using a laptop on a train journey from Bratislava to the Tatras. Note that tethering uses data at a faster rate.
Can I make local phone calls with an eSIM?
Most travel eSIMs for Slovakia are data-only. Use internet-based calling apps like WhatsApp, Skype, or Google Meet over your data connection to call locally or internationally.
What if I use all my data?
Many providers allow you to purchase a top-up or a new data package online immediately, so you can recharge even while touring the caves of the Slovak Karst.
Can I have multiple eSIMs for different countries?
Yes. You can store profiles for Slovakia, Austria, Hungary, etc., on your phone and switch between them as you travel, though usually only one can be active for data at a time.
How long is an eSIM plan valid?
Validity varies (7, 14, 30 days are common). Choose a plan that covers your entire stay, from your first day in Bratislava to your last hike in the High Tatras.
How do I check my phone's eSIM compatibility?
Visit your device manufacturer's website or check in your phone's settings under 'About' or 'Network'. Most unlocked phones from 2018 onward support eSIM.
Do I need to take out my home SIM card?
No. Use Dual SIM functionality. Your physical SIM stays in for calls/texts, while the eSIM handles all your Slovak mobile data needs seamlessly.
